Hi there,

I have been searching for ages, and can't find the answer!

I noticed in most cases renewals of Permanent Residency Cards are mailed to your address. But in what circumstances does CIC get you to pick it up in person?

I ask this (even though it's a long way off) in the instance that I may be inside Canada for the application to be sent, but in the event that the application gets delayed, and I am not able to stay for the entire processing time. I would intend to have it sent to my mother-in-laws house who can then send it to me, but am worried this isn't a hard and fast process.

I have just heard of cases where others have applied inside Canada, and had to leave, then weren't able to pick up their PR card within the specified timeframe. If you are from a VISA exempt country like Australia, is it as simple as reapplying after being able to return to Canada even though the PR card has expired, or is it more complicated?

If you are asked to pick up the PR card and you are unable to, you should let CIC know and ask to reschedule your pick up appointment. I believe they keep your PR card at the local office for about 6 months and if you have not been able to pick it up by then, they will send it back to CIC headquarters and destroy it and you will have to apply for another.

If you are visa exempt, you can fly to Canada on the strength of your visa exempt passport. When you arrive at immigration, you show your expired PR card or might not yet be expired depending on when you applied to renew. They will let you enter and you can pick up your card.

For somebody who is not visa exempt, it is not that simple. They would not be able to fly without a visa or a valid PR card so if their card had expired, they would have to apply for a travel document or if they have a US visa, they could go to the US, rent a car and drive to Canada.

IIRC from an Operational Bulletin CIC require around 10% of applicants to collect their cards from the local office. There is a random element to this for program integrity/ quality control as well as suspect residency cases where they need to verify details of your presence in Canada. A trend on the forum is for applicants who apply when abroad and mail their applications to someone in Canada who then forwards to CIC to be required to pick up renewed PR Card at the local office.

Note that at Card Pick up CIC may determine you have not met the Residence Obligation due to your recent absence i.e. you applied at the 730 day mark left Canada soon after card processing delayed then you are required to pick up the card in person....by this time you are in breach of the RO.
